their system does not allow you to pay for a lease if you use a MAC or if you use anything other than IE.
They also refuse paper checks.
If you can avoid leasing from them do so.
If you can avoid parking in one of their lots or garages do so.
If you own a lot or garage - FIND ANOTHER VENDOR!!!
Pros: none but they manage so most of the lots and garages in pgh
Cons: can't lease from them if you are not web savvy or use a MAC